KFC in Jamaica, Queens holds a current Grade A from NYC DOHMH, scoring 10 points on its most recent inspection. With 2 inspections on record between 2024 and 2025, the restaurant has received Grade A on both occasions and has no emergency closures on record.

What is KFC's current health grade?
KFC currently holds a Grade A. This is the highest possible grade, indicating a score of 0–13 points.

What was the worst inspection score at KFC?
The worst inspection score recorded at KFC was 10 points on November 6, 2025. In NYC, a score of 14 or above means Grade B, and 28+ means Grade C.
